My invention relates to a pavement useful on streets and roadways of all sorts but particularly intended to be laid on streets over which there is heavy trucking traflic, and the object of the invention is primarily to provide an, indestructible pavement ca- .pable of sustaining the heaviest loads and affording a secure foothold for horses and a good traction surface for motor driven vehicles.
I attain this end by certain novel features which'will be fully set forth hereinafter and particularly pointed out in the claims.
The accompanying drawings represent, as an example, one of the various fornis into which the principles of my invention may be practically embodied and in-these drawings, Figure '1 is a plan view of the pavement; Fig". 2 is a vertical section thereof; and Fig. 3 is -an enlarged vertical section clearly illustrating the manner of tying together the reinforce sections. 3
, In constructing the pavement' a suitable bed,or foundation is laid as indicated at a in Figs. 2 and 3. The nature of this foundation or bed is entirely immaterial excepting that it should be sutliciently strong to carry the weight of the pavement and its superimposed load.
- The pavement is constructed of a suitable paving material laidlastic and allowed to harden and reinforce with iron. The pave- ,ment material employed for this purpose may be varied to suit the conditions to be met. For heavy traffic, however, I prefer to employ ordinary concrete. In the drawings terial which is laid plastic and allowed to harden in the usual manner.
c'indicates the reinforce sections which are entirely separate from each other and other metallic materiaLand, accordingto the form of the invention illustrated, in the drawings, .these sections are rectangular in dg'est on edge on the foundation or t bed a; the upper edges of the sections c be ing exposed above the surface or me paving material Z) to furnish a foothold for horses and an eifective traction surface for motor to the shape of the reinforce sections which a continuous skeleton or net-like frame or reinforce. The sections may be secured together by various devices but I prefer the ties d shown best in Fig. 3. Said ties have laterally bent ends cl forming hooks which reinforce sections 0 and ,after the concrete or other paving material hardens around them they form a firm rigid connection between the reinforce sections.
The pavement thus constructed is of the lm ostdurable character. The concrete or other paving material cannot crack because it is divided into numerous small bodies by the reinforce sections and should any one of these bodies become injured at any time it may be readily broken out independently of the remainder of the pavement and a new section laid in its place. If a section of the pavement is to be taken up for repair or for sewers under the street this may be readily done by removing as many of the reinforce sections a and connections d as may be required and after the necessary perfectly both in appearance and structure with the remainder of the pavement.
